How Prophase Actually Works

Prophase is the first stage of mitosis, the process by which a cell divides to form two daughter cells that are genetically identical to the parent cell. During prophase, the chromosomes become visible under a microscope, and the nucleolus disappears. The sister chromatids are still joined at the centromere, but the nuclear envelope begins to break down, initiating the separation process. This critical phase involves the condensation of chromatin and the formation of the spindle fibers that will play a crucial role in chromosomes' separation.

What triggers the start of prophase?

Prophase is triggered by a signal from the cell, indicating that it's time to prepare for cell division. This signal can come from various sources, including hormones and growth factors.

How does prophase differ from other cell cycle phases?

Unlike other phases, prophase is characterized by the condensation of chromatin and the formation of spindle fibers. This distinct process prepares the cell for cell division, ensuring that genetic material is accurately distributed.
